Ethical Considerations for Utilizing 123b: Responsible AI Development

Developing and deploying advanced AI models like 123b presents a unique set of ethical challenges that require careful consideration. Explainability in the decision-making processes of these models is crucial to build trust and ensure fairness. It is essential to address potential biases that may be inherent in the training data, as they can perpetuate discrimination. Furthermore, the impact of 123b on society, including its potential for job displacement and the spread of misinformation, must be carefully assessed. Public dialogue and collaboration between AI developers, policymakers, and the public are essential to define ethical guidelines and regulations that promote responsible AI development and deployment.
